Denim Denim Denim and more Denim

“I’ve attempted to develop a relaxed street aesthetic through focus to texture, colors, and silhouette, and detailing derived from a mix of American and Korean componets." - Hye Gin Hamm

For once I don't have much to say, because her work speaks for itself.

Out of all the collections I've seen this season so far, I would wear this one first with no hesitation. Every piece is detailed and well thought out.  

Designer Hye Gin Hamm is a Graduating student from Parsons, where she was awarded the opportunity to showcase her collection in a competition " Empowering Imagination "for the industry during fashion week. HAMM not only moved the judges but the audience with her use of 100% Cotton Denim for her entire Collection! Hye stone washed and bleached her collection herself to give it that ombre look. Amok at the Chateau.

“The fashion industry is retarded. It doesn’t make sense. There is too much product out there and when you’re a wholesale business it’s really impossible to resolve. You can’t, because if you want to be in a store like Barney’s, you can’t just deliver twice a year. You can’t just have two runway shows.” -Scott Sternberg

 

Band Of Outsiders Spring 2014

WHEN IT COMES to fashion shows, Scott Sternberg is nothing but original!. 

Okay so let me give you the details, they actually live streamed this collection from Hotel Chateau Marmont's Rm. 29.  The show was prepped to depict the lifestyle of a touring musician. Folk musician Devendra Banhart was the model elected to not leave the room until all 20 outfits were tried on and modeled about.

Hood By Air

"The tees would say ‘HOOD.' They were something we'd rock around town, almost to be obnoxious. We'd be running around wearing heels with parts down the middle of our hair, but wearing these t-shirts that said ‘Hood,' just to mix it up. I'd sometimes get into altercations with people over [the shirts], but at least I knew there was power in something I made." -Shayne Oliver 
 


This is NYFW Hood By Air Spring 2014 Collection. This is the best Collection i have seen in a very long time. Not only is it innovative and different but very trendsetting.  

Hood By Air started in 2006 with just "HOOD"graphic t-shirts, and now is one of the most exciting street wear brands today. Designer Shayne Oliver did not give us the typical streetwear collection, with oversized sweaters and high-top sneakers. He gave us High Fashion. 

The show was Titled “Gump” and during the show you could hear booms and clashes that sounded like scraping metals. There were plenty of logos, lots of zippers, button downs, and nylon ropes inspired by Asian parachutist uniforms that brought a dark edge to the collection. 

Androgyny was an understatement. The ambiguity of models and pieces that were put together, like the skirts and shorts; brought an interesting no gender at all edge.

Music=Fashion

"When I was in middle school, I liked punk rock, and I started to become interested in clothes because I wanted to wear the same clothes as my favorite singers. Therefore, the simple rule of "music=fashion" has not changed for me."  -Takeshi Osumi 

 

This is PHENOMENON 2013 Spring/Summer Tokyo ready to wear Collection.  

Phenomenon was founded in 2004. What i love about Takeshi Osumi is, his collection is very unique to be a street wear brand. The concept of Phenomenon is Music. His clothes have an influence of hip-hop and urban life, but there is still beauty in every look. 

 In Spring/Summer 2013, Phenomenon gave us color blocking, clean lines, and smooth patterns. This collection is what K.J. stands for. Travel in Style

"I do this job for only one reason: to see my collection on people," says Mattiussi.

Its crazy to think its only been two years since the French designer Alexandre Mattiussi started his Ami fashion line. Before Ami he was working for Dior, Givenchy and Marc Jacobs. Alexandre has taken over and is becoming known for his fun, elegant, and well tailored sportswear. 

The backdrop of the Ami 2014 spring runway show was a recreation of a 1950 retro chic French airport. 

Mattiussi took the slogan flying with style literally. In the fifties men and women dressed up to fly. When you walked into the airport you would see a mix of businessmen in suits, young men hustling through the terminal with shirts tied around their waists, and men with bright tropical printed shirts on their way to holiday vacation. 

This show wasn't necessarily about creating a new outlook on fashion. It was about having an entire collection of classics. What i love the most is that every look is sophisticated yet comfortable and put together!

Fresh

"If someone realizes the piece they are wearing is inspired by me then it only broadens my audience."

-Alexander Wang 

 

2014 Spring Menswear Collection 

Leather in Summer? That is all i see this season. Growing up if i wanted to wear leather/Suede my mother would say it was unacceptable in spring/summer. Today it is very much accepted! 

Alexander brought a fresh new edge to Spring/Summer. The way he cut and diced the leather and added it to every piece is exciting to me. Wang made leather look clean, light and free, which is very important for summer. Alexander Wang always stays true to its casual athletic edge, and i love love love him for it.

COLOR COLOR COLOR

 "When Christopher Shannon was a kid going out to clubs in Liverpool and Manchester he always wanted to dress up and stand out. A cheap way of doing this was a little glitter spray so we took inspiration from Christopher's love of glitter and the super club scene and completely covered the model's heads in coloured glitter and finishing it off with our Fudge Glitter Blast hair spray,"

-John Vial Stylist and Fudge creative director.

Today Christopher Shannon showed his London 2014 Spring Collection!

As someone who loves and studies fashion i am very particular on what I wear. This is the first runway show I've viewed, and genuinely liked and wanted to wear every single piece.  I'm all for Mixing Urban, Preppy and a little bit of the future together, and that's what he did.

My favorite piece is the Sneakers, they are made to look like Sandals with socks. The bold Color choices, Patterns, and adding Suede to spring made me very excited for the future of menswear!
